A kind of antirust coating composition and preparation method thereof
A technology of antirust coating and composition, which is applied in the field of antirust coating composition and its preparation, can solve the problems of complex production process, high price, easy aging, etc., and achieve simple production process, anti-aging and low cost Effect

Embodiment 1
[0010] An antirust coating composition, the composition of which is expressed in parts by mass: 50 parts of butyl acetate, 80 parts of acrylate and styrene copolymer, 1.2 parts of modified polysiloxane, and 2 parts of chlorinated paraffin , 2 parts of triphenylphosphite, 0.3 parts of ultraviolet absorber, 1.2 parts of hindered amine light stabilizer.
[0011] The preparation method of this embodiment includes the following steps: according to the mass ratio, acrylate and styrene copolymer, modified polysiloxane, chlorinated paraffin, phosphorous triphenyl ester, ultraviolet absorber, hindered amine photostabilization Add the agent to butyl acetate and mix well.
Embodiment 2
[0013] An antirust coating composition, the composition of which is expressed in parts by mass: 60 parts of butyl acetate, 90 parts of acrylate and styrene copolymer, 2 parts of modified polysiloxane, and 3 parts of chlorinated paraffin , 3 parts of triphenylphosphite, 0.6 parts of ultraviolet absorber, 1.2 parts of hindered amine light stabilizer.
[0014] The preparation method of this embodiment includes the following steps: according to the mass ratio, acrylate and styrene copolymer, modified polysiloxane, chlorinated paraffin, phosphorous triphenyl ester, ultraviolet absorber, hindered amine photostabilization Add the agent to butyl acetate and mix well.
Embodiment 3
[0016] An antirust coating composition, the composition of which is expressed in parts by mass: 55 parts of butyl acetate, 85 parts of acrylate and styrene copolymer, 1.6 parts of modified polysiloxane, and 2.5 parts of chlorinated paraffin , 2.2 parts of triphenylphosphite, 0.5 parts of ultraviolet absorber, and 1.2 parts of hindered amine light stabilizer.
[0017] The preparation method of this embodiment includes the following steps: according to the mass ratio, acrylate and styrene copolymer, modified polysiloxane, chlorinated paraffin, phosphorous triphenyl ester, ultraviolet absorber, hindered amine photostabilization Add the agent to butyl acetate and mix well.
[0018] All components in the above examples are commercially available.
